Telling the story of your day

Photo books are the modern alternative to traditional photo albums. In the past you would make prints of your pictures and slot them into an album to keep them safe and share them with your family. You might even have your grandparents wedding album passed down to you? With photo books, the photographs are printed directly onto the pages of the book, with each page designed to fit around your style and photos.

What are the benefits of having a wedding album?

It is very popular these days to keep your photos digitally, on a computer. While there are advantages of this, we believe nothing can replace the experience of seeing a physical print. For this reason we would always encourage you to have a digital copy of all your wedding photos as well as a select few in a modern album.

If you keep your wedding album on a shelf under the coffee table or on the sideboard, it is easily at hand to share with your friends and family. This means that your photos are likely to be seen more than if they were left on a USB stick in the drawer. Beautiful images of one of the most special days of your life deserve to be displayed in your home and shared with your nearest and dearest.

The ultimate benefit that we go on and on about is being able to set aside some time on your anniversary each year to sit together, look through your album and relive your wedding day. This has been a tradition for myself and Jason with our own wedding album that we just love!

How many photos can I have in my wedding album?

Although there is no limit we suggest trying to select around 60-80 images from your full wedding day. The purpose of an album is to tell the story of the day from start to finish, showcasing the highlights. On average, a good indicator is to allocate 5 images per double page spread. Of course this can be adjusted to your preference - if you would like fewer pictures per page, that is absolutely fine. We find having about 30-50 pages in total is an ideal amount.

What kind of paper do you use?

All of our wedding albums are made with Lustre paper, as are our prints. This is our favourite paper type due to it being silky - not glossy or matt - with just a slight shine. The pages are lay-flat which means they don't dip in at the spine; infact you can have a large photograph spread across a double page without any of the image being concealed at the center.
